[QUOTE="Allen, post: 107005, member: 389"] You don't need a triple. I run a dual bank to charge the trolling batteries and a single bank to top off the starting battery. All you have to do is run an extension cord under your floor up into the storage compartment where your dual bank is stored, then use a [IMG]http://ecx.images-amazon.com/images/I/41z9PeB1XdL.jpg[/IMG] Voila, one cord to plug in and all three batteries are being charged, all the while keeping your systems separate. [COLOR="silver"][SIZE=1]- - - Updated - - -[/SIZE][/COLOR] FWIW, my older Lowrance P.O.S. 480 has a voltage display on it, but it is pure crap. Even when the battery is new and fully charged it only registers around 12 V. A new 12V battery when charged is more like 12.6V, or with the engine running it can be up to around 13 - 14V, or something dumb like that. I NEVER see numbers that high on my Lowrance. It used to cause great consternation with me, but I've learned to ignore the damn Lowrance's advertised voltage. [/QUOTE]
